Rectangular cake divided in to two equal parts in one attempt.(microsoft 2012 riddle)

Puzzle:
Given a rectangular (cuboidal for the puritans) cake with a rectangular piece removed (any size or orientation), how would you cut the remainder of the cake into two equal halves with one straight cut of a knife?

Solution:
Join the centers of the original and the removed rectangle.
It works for cuboids too! BTW, I have been getting many questions asking why a horizontal slice across the middle will not do. Please note the "any size or orientation" in the question! Don't get boxed in by the way you cut your birthday cake Think out of the box.

